Re: NORD STAGE 4 officially announced for February 16th 2023

Post by anotherscott »

Any time a company takes something away that an older model had, some people will be disappointed. It doesn't mean the decision didn't make sense, because there are also other design considerations involved. As always, people can vote with their wallets. But boards are not custom made for us, and we rarely get everything you want. Nord has decided that, if we need to split/layer more than 3 sounds that are not in the piano or organ category, we need to use a different board. (ETA: Or, alternate approach, discussed below.)

That said, splitting/layering up to 2 piano, 2 organ, and 3 other sounds will still probably cover most users, and in fact, will probably give more people more useful combinations than they had in the previous fixed "2-internal/2-external" arrangement. I think it's probably a net positive overall... but I understand that won't console those users who actually did need to combine 2 internal synth sounds with 2 external sounds.

But also, these days, so many people are using laptops or iPads/iPhones for their external sounds... and those devices are so versatile that you can actually pretty easily set them up so that calling up a single Extern sound from your Nord could itself invoke multiple split/layered sounds from within the external device. (And actually, even most external hardware sound modules can do this.) So in fact, it is pretty likely that you can still have your 2 internal synth sounds along with two external sounds, even with the external sounds being invoked by a single Extern zone of the NS4 (albeit at a loss of some of the independent front panel control for the different sounds that you had before). You just have to configure that second external sound on the external device itself. It's not un-doable. And if you're using external devices in the first place, you're probably MIDI-savvy enough to figure out how to do it. (Probably about the only time this won't work is when you're getting your external sounds from a second keyboard. Some keyboards are good about letting an external keyboard trigger multiple sounds split/layered over a single incoming MIDI channel connection, but other boards are not.)

Re: NORD STAGE 4 officially announced for February 16th 2023

Post by WannitBBBad »

ericL wrote:I think one way to imagine the possibilities for this use case, would be having two adjacent Programs that can seamlessly switch from the internal to the external ecosystem...perhaps this could even happen as part of the Layer Scene switching...the Program could transition from using 1-3 internal + 0-2 external to 3 external or similar.
I agree, changing to another program would seem to be the best way to swap between using different int/ext synth setups as the settings of the three synth layers can't change between scenes, only whether they are on or off. Your comment makes me wonder what would happen during performance if the change from internal to external occurs. Shifting to extern for a solo and then shifting back to the programmed internal synth (not sure if one hand can cover the two-button shift), might be practical in some cases. I guess we'll have to see how the NS4 is set up for that scenario; for example, will it return to the last state of the internal synth, or will it include any control made while in the extern mode? We'll see.
